Japan Banking Credit Analytics Market By Type Segment Analysis

The Japan Banking Credit Analytics Market is primarily classified into three core segments: Risk Assessment Analytics, Fraud Detection & Prevention Analytics, and Customer Credit Scoring Analytics. Risk Assessment Analytics encompasses tools and models used by banks to evaluate the creditworthiness of borrowers, leveraging historical data, financial statements, and macroeconomic indicators. Fraud Detection & Prevention Analytics focuses on identifying suspicious activities and potential frauds through pattern recognition, anomaly detection, and real-time monitoring systems. Customer Credit Scoring Analytics involves developing predictive models to assign credit scores to individual and corporate clients, facilitating faster decision-making and risk mitigation. These classifications are driven by the evolving regulatory landscape, increasing digital transaction volumes, and the need for enhanced risk management frameworks within the banking sector.

Market size estimates for these segments suggest that Risk Assessment Analytics holds the largest share, accounting for approximately 45-50% of the total credit analytics market in Japan, driven by the high demand for comprehensive risk management solutions. Customer Credit Scoring Analytics is projected to grow at a CAGR of around 12% over the next five years, fueled by digital onboarding processes and personalized banking services. Fraud Detection & Prevention Analytics, although currently representing about 20-25% of the market, is anticipated to experience the fastest growth, with a projected CAGR of approximately 14-15%, as banks prioritize cybersecurity and fraud mitigation strategies. The market is in a growing stage, with increasing adoption of advanced analytics tools, machine learning, and AI-driven solutions, which are transforming traditional credit assessment practices. Key growth accelerators include regulatory mandates for improved risk transparency, rising digital banking adoption, and technological innovations such as AI and big data analytics, which enhance predictive accuracy and operational efficiency.

Japan Banking Credit Analytics Market By Application Segment Analysis

The application segments within the Japan Banking Credit Analytics Market are primarily categorized into Retail Banking, Corporate Banking, and Small and Medium Enterprise (SME) Banking. Retail Banking applications focus on individual consumers, utilizing credit scoring, risk profiling, and personalized credit offerings to enhance customer experience and reduce default rates. Corporate Banking applications serve large enterprises, employing advanced risk assessment and portfolio analytics to optimize credit exposure and manage complex financial relationships. SME Banking, a rapidly expanding segment, leverages tailored credit analytics to support small and medium-sized business financing, which is crucial for Japan’s economic growth. The market size for retail banking applications remains dominant, accounting for roughly 50-55% of the total credit analytics market, driven by increasing digital engagement and consumer credit demand. Meanwhile, SME and corporate banking segments are experiencing accelerated growth, with CAGR estimates of 13-15%, propelled by government initiatives and digital transformation efforts aimed at supporting business growth and financial inclusion.

The market is currently in a growth stage across all application segments, with digitalization and regulatory reforms acting as key growth catalysts. Retail banking is maturing with widespread adoption of AI-powered credit scoring and customer insights solutions, while SME and corporate segments are emerging as high-growth areas due to targeted fintech collaborations and innovative credit models. The fastest-growing application segment is SME banking, expected to grow at a CAGR of approximately 14%, driven by increased demand for tailored credit solutions and risk management tools. Technological advancements such as machine learning, big data analytics, and real-time data integration are significantly enhancing credit decision accuracy and operational efficiency across all segments. Regulatory pressures for transparency and risk mitigation further accelerate adoption, especially in underserved SME markets, creating substantial growth opportunities for innovative analytics providers.
